Toronto's revenues down
The Anglican
Jun 1, 2003
The diocese of Toronto, feeling the sting from the slump in financial markets, is facing a gap this year of $750,000 between anticipated income and the budget forecast approved by synod in 2001. The diocese has narrowed the gap to $400,000 by stopping $350,000 in planned expenditures this year. A group of clergy and laity will look at making further cuts, but they will have to be weighed against the diocese's ability to carry out its mission. "Synod expects us to have balanced budgets," said Alison Knight, chief administrative officer.
